Unai Emery’s detailed approach to match preparation is considered among the most methodical systems in top-level professional football. As a tactical specialist, Emery believes that games are decided before players step onto the pitch. His preparation process combines statistical research, opponent profiling, and training-ground simulations. Unlike managers who rely heavily on spontaneity or emotional momentum, Emery emphasizes planning, repetition, and clarity. This philosophy has allowed him to excel in knockout competitions. A central pillar of Emery’s match preparation is in-depth opponent analysis. Before every match, Emery and his coaching staff break down hours of match footage. They focus on defensive lines, attacking transitions, and set-piece routines. Emery pays special attention to weaknesses. He identifies key battles, dangerous movements, and structural flaws. This information is then simplified into actionable concepts. Rather than overwhelming players with data, Emery ensures that each instruction is specific. This balance between deep research and clarity defines his preparation style and allows players to enter matches with confidence.
Another defining element of Unai Emery’s tactical planning is position-based training. Emery believes that clarity of role leads to collective strength. In training sessions leading up to a match, players receive custom drills tailored to their position. Full-backs may work on overlapping runs, defensive timing, and recovery speed. Midfielders focus on positional discipline and decision-making. Forwards rehearse counter-pressing actions and off-ball runs. This approach ensures that every player feels prepared. Emery’s belief is that knowledge empowers players, especially in high-pressure matches.
Training intensity during Unai Emery’s weekly preparation is carefully managed. Emery avoids unnecessary physical strain. Instead, he emphasizes quality over quantity. Sessions are designed around tactical themes. Small-sided games replicate pressing situations, numerical advantages, and transitions. Emery frequently uses situational training exercises to prepare players for likely game states. This ensures that when similar situations arise on matchday, players react instinctively. Emery’s training ground philosophy reflects his belief that rehearsed behaviors lead to consistency.
Psychological preparation is another key aspect of Emery’s matchday approach. Emery understands that confidence influences performance. In the days leading up to a game, he works to balance motivation and calmness. Team talks are direct and focused. Emery avoids emotional exaggeration. Instead, he reinforces trust in the game plan. Players are reminded that every scenario has been rehearsed. This psychological clarity allows players to make better decisions. Emery’s calm demeanor on the touchline further reinforces this mental stability, showing players that discipline brings results.
Matchday itself is the execution phase of the tactical buildup. On game day, Emery’s routines are carefully repeated. He believes that familiarity reduces stress. Pre-match meetings are used to highlight critical details. Visual aids such as short highlight reels are often employed to reinforce roles. Emery avoids confusing instructions. Instead, he focuses on discipline within the structure. This approach ensures that players feel prepared rather than surprised.
One of the most notable traits of Emery’s tactical mindset is flexibility within structure. While Emery is known for detailed planning, he also prepares multiple tactical options. Players are trained to recognize tactical triggers. For example, a team may adjust pressing height based on scoreline. These adjustments are not improvised but discussed in advance. This allows Emery’s teams to respond effectively to unexpected challenges. Flexibility without chaos is a hallmark of Emery’s preparation.
Set-piece preparation plays a major emphasis in Unai Emery’s planning process. Emery understands that set pieces can decide tight matches. His teams spend considerable time rehearsing corners, free kicks, and throw-ins. Every movement is precisely timed. Defensive responsibilities are clearly assigned. Attacking routines are adjusted based on scouting reports. This attention to detail often gives Emery’s teams an advantage in knockout games. Set-piece success is not accidental but a direct result of preparation.
Communication is a foundation of his coaching. Emery ensures that players receive consistent messages. Language barriers, especially in diverse dressing rooms, are addressed through simple phrasing, visual aids, and repetition. Emery believes that clarity prevents confusion. Throughout the week, players are constantly reminded of key principles. This communication extends to analyst coordination. Everyone works toward shared tactical vision. This unity is essential for matchday execution.
Video analysis is heavily relied upon in the Emery coaching system. Players regularly attend video sessions highlighting strengths and weaknesses. Clips are carefully selected. Emery avoids excessive analysis. Instead, each clip has a defined objective. This visual learning helps players recognize patterns faster. By combining analysis with training, Emery ensures that concepts are naturally executed during matches.
Physical conditioning within Emery’s preparation framework is strategically planned. Emery collaborates closely with sports scientists and conditioning experts. Workloads are adjusted based on data. This ensures that players reduce injury risk. Recovery sessions, including mobility-focused exercises, are integral to the process. Emery understands that fresh players think faster. This holistic approach ensures that physical preparation complements tactical planning.

In-game preparation is another unique strength of the Emery approach. Before kickoff, Emery prepares tactical contingencies. Assistants monitor opponent adjustments. This allows Emery to respond quickly to developments. Substitutions are rarely reactive. This foresight ensures that changes enhance structure throughout the match.
Post-match analysis feeds directly back into the Emery feedback loop. After every game, the staff conducts comprehensive evaluations. Strengths are reinforced, while weaknesses are addressed in training. This constant loop of study, apply, evaluate, and adapt ensures long-term development. Emery believes that learning never stops.
